How do I use CourseFinder to find a Course?

If you are looking for a particular course or subject, simply type a key word like "Art" or "English" or "Bricklaying" in the box under Find Course. Then click the Send button. A list of courses should appear. From the list you can click Course Title or Provided by to see more information.

How do I use it to find a Provider?

You can find information about the organisations (providers) who offer courses in much the same way.
Simply type a key word such as "Sunderland" (College), "Rathbone" (Work Based Learning Provider) or "Saints" (for All Saints College) in the box under Find Provider. Then click the Go button. A list of providers should appear. From the list you can click Organisation to see contact details or Options to view the courses offered by that provider.

What if I still don't find what I'm looking for?

If you don't get a result from any of these searches, check your spelling or try typing in a different key word. For example, searching for 'plumber' will not find any matches, but entering 'plumbing' or 'plumb' will give a result.
